Having the same in Ubuntu 13.10,
@fkalman a note for using aptitude,
an sudo aptitude safe-upgrade works, but seems to remove some packages :
icu-tools{u} libcmis-0.3-3{u} libpoppler28{u} openjdk-7-jre-lib{u}. I
wouldn't use aptitude as a workaround.
